So schützen Sie eine Excel-Datei in C# mit einem Kennwort

Dieses kurze Tutorial zeigt wie man eine Excel-Datei in C# mit einem Passwort schützt mit Hilfe aller notwendigen Schritte zur Konfiguration der IDE und detaillierter Schritte zum Schreiben der Anwendung. Es bietet auch einen ausführbaren Beispielcode, der den Prozess zum Verschlüsseln einer Excel-Datei mit Kennwort in C# zeigt. Außerdem erfahren Sie mehr über verschiedene Verschlüsselungsarten, das Festlegen von Passwörtern und das Speichern der Ausgabedatei in verschiedenen Formaten wie XLSX, XLS, ODS usw.

Schritte zum Passwortschutz von Excel in C#

  1. Richten Sie die Umgebung ein, um Aspose.Cells for .NET zum Verschlüsseln einer Excel-Datei zu verwenden
  2. Laden oder erstellen Sie eine Excel-Datei mit dem Klassenobjekt Workbook
  3. Legen Sie die erforderlichen Verschlüsselungsoptionen für die geladene Arbeitsmappe mit der Methode SetEncryptionOptions() fest
  4. Legen Sie das Passwort für die Datei fest
  5. Speichern Sie die verschlüsselte Arbeitsmappe auf der Festplatte

Diese Schritte beschreiben den Prozess zum Kennwortschutz der Excel-Datei in C#, sodass zuerst die Excel-Quelldatei geladen wird und dann die SetEncryptionOptions()-Methode verwendet wird, um verschiedene Verschlüsselungseigenschaften für die Tabelle festzulegen. Nach diesen Schritten müssen wir nur das Passwort festlegen, das zum Öffnen der Excel-Datei erforderlich ist, und dann die ausgegebene Excel-Datei in Ihrem gewünschten Format speichern.

Code zum Verschlüsseln der Arbeitsmappe mit Kennwort in C#

Dieser Code demonstriert den Prozess zum Verschlüsseln einer Excel-Datei in C# mithilfe der SetEncryptionOptions()-Methode, die einen der Verschlüsselungstypwerte wie StrongCryptographicProvider, EnhancedCryptographicProviderV1, Compatible oder XOR und die Schlüssellänge annimmt. Das Settings-Objekt in der Workbook-Klasse verfügt über die Kennworteigenschaft, die festgelegt und erforderlich ist, um die Workbook nach der Verschlüsselung zu öffnen. Sobald die Arbeitsmappe verschlüsselt ist, kann sie in jedem der von MS Excel unterstützten Formate gespeichert werden.

In diesem Artikel haben wir gelernt, die Excel-Datei zu verschlüsseln. Wenn Sie lernen möchten, wie Sie einer Arbeitsmappe eine digitale Signatur hinzufügen, lesen Sie den Artikel zu So fügen Sie eine digitale Signatur in Excel mit C# hinzu.

 Deutsch